Maximaa Systems  (BOM:526538) Net Current Asset Value Explanation

Benjamin Graham first discussed net current asset value (NCAV) in the 1934 edition of "Security Analysis", which he coauthored with David Dodd. In the book, (net) current asset value is defined as:" current assets alone, minus all liabilities and claims ahead of the issue."

The common definition of NCAV is: NCAV = current assets – [total liabilities + minority interest + preferred stock]

Net current assets exclude not only the intangible assets but also the fixed and miscellaneous assets. In addition, Graham believed that preferred stock belongs on the liability side of the balance sheet, not as part of capital and surplus. In "Security Analysis", preferred stock is dubbed "an imperfect creditorship position" that is best placed on the balance sheet alongside funded debt.

One research study, covering the years 1970 through 1983 showed that portfolios picked at the beginning of each year, and held for one year, returned 29.4 percent, on average, over the 13-year period, compared to 11.5 percent for the S&P 500 Index. Other studies of Graham’s strategy produced similar results.

Maximaa Systems Business Description

Address Tithal Road, B-1, Yashkamal, Valsad, GJ, IND, 396 001
Maximaa Systems Ltd is an India-based company engaged in the business divisions of Storage systems and the Pharma division. The company provides a heavy-duty pallet racking system, medium duty racking system, drive in the storage system, slotted angle rack, two-tier, three-tier racking system, mobile storage system, compactors, furniture storages, and others. Additionally, the company offers healthcare products for bone and joint care, hair care, neuro care, skincare, and other products.
